When you call for a chimney repair estimate, a few main things influence the final bill. The height of your home and how easily technicians can reach the chimney stack often dictate labor costs. The specific materials needed—whether you are dealing with standard brick, custom stone, or specialized flue liners—also play a part. Repairs involving structural masonry work or internal firebox reconstruction require more time than simple cap replacements or mortar joint touch-ups. Summer is a practical time for chimney maintenance because masonry work cures best in warmer, dry conditions. If you have been putting off repairs, the stable weather allows technicians to work efficiently on your roof or exterior chimney stack. Chimney flashing repair near Kent involves inspecting and mending the metal barrier where your chimney meets your roof. This is crucial for preventing water from seeping into your home, which is a common issue in our climate. Damaged flashing can lead to significant water damage in your attic and walls. Signs of needing emergency chimney repair in Kent include visible structural damage, such as a leaning chimney, significant cracking, or smoke entering your home when it shouldn't. A sudden lack of draft or a strong odor of smoke indoors also warrants immediate attention. For any urgent concerns, call us right away for a prompt assessment and free estimate.
